Types of Esports that Demand Psychological Intervention

In the fascinating universe of esports, where competition is woven with cables and pulses of light, the player’s mind becomes an invaluable resource. Psychological intervention stands as a beacon, guiding players through the choppy seas of emotions and strategies. Before we dive into the need for this intervention, we’ll explore the different types of esports, each with their own set of psychological challenges. From cerebral real-time strategy games to exciting team esports and fast-paced sports games, each category demands a unique psychological approach.

  1. Real Time Strategy (RTS) Games: In titles like StarCraft II, players must make quick and precise decisions. The psychological intervention here focuses on stress management during intense games and developing concentration to evaluate and execute strategies in real time.
  2. Team Electronic Sports (MOBA): Games like Dota 2 and League of Legends require fluid communication and coordination between players. Sports psychologists work on building team trust, conflict resolution, and effective communication techniques.
  3. First Person Shooter (FPS): In titles like Counter-Strike: Global Offensive, precision and mental speed are essential. Psychological intervention focuses on stress management, the development of self-confidence and adaptability to changing situations.
  4. Sports Games: Esports like FIFA or NBA 2K simulate traditional sports. Here, the intervention focuses on psychological aspects similar to physical sports, such as mental resistance, pressure management and building the self-confidence necessary to face critical situations in the game.

Key Variables Worked on by the Sports Psychologist

At the exciting intersection between digital prowess and mental toughness, esports has transformed competition into a field where the mind is as vital as keyboard and mouse skills. These are the key variables that these experts meticulously work on, forging the key to success in the exciting and challenging world of esports.

  • Self-efficacy: Self-efficacy refers to a player’s belief in his or her ability to successfully execute a specific task. Sports psychologists work to strengthen the self-efficacy of players, helping them recognize and take advantage of their strengths. They set achievable goals and foster experiences of success, thus contributing to a lasting sense of self-confidence. A player with high self-efficacy is more likely to face challenges with determination and maintain consistent performance even in demanding situations.
  • Emotional Regulation: In esports, where the emotional intensity can be overwhelming, emotional regulation is essential. Sports psychologists work with players to identify and understand their emotions during the game. They develop effective strategies to manage stress, frustration and anxiety. The ability to remain calm under pressure and direct emotions constructively results in more consistent performance and clearer decision making.
  • Resilience: Resilience is the ability to quickly recover from defeats and learn from adverse experiences. Sports psychologists cultivate resilience by teaching players to see losses as opportunities for growth. They encourage a learning mindset, helping players analyze their mistakes without letting them negatively affect their self-esteem. Resilience is essential in a competitive environment where inevitable defeats can become stepping stones to future success.
  • Adaptability: The dynamic nature of esports requires great adaptability. Sports psychologists work on developing players’ ability to adjust to changing situations, adverse strategies and variable playing environments. Adaptability involves being able to change tactics, remain calm in times of uncertainty, and take advantage of unexpected opportunities. Players who are adaptable are valuable assets to their teams, as they can meet challenges with flexibility and creativity.

Together, these key variables form the fabric of mental toughness in esports. The sports psychologist not only addresses the technical aspects of the game, but also works on building a solid psychological foundation that allows players to excel in a field where the mind is as crucial as digital skill. Balancing these variables paves the way for optimal, sustainable performance in the exciting world of esports.
